Web6 uur geleden · The Labor senator says she’s been boiling eggs wrapped in foil in the microwave for 25 years or more, ‘and I’ve never had a mishap’ Labor senator Helen … Web13 apr. 2024 · In 15th-century Zurich, for example, there was a methodology in place using the breaking wheel. According to the History Collection, victims were laid facedown on a board with the wheel placed on their backs. They were struck a total of nine times — twice in each arm and leg, and once in the spine.
